2010-12-10 5 views
0

Quelle est la meilleure fonction à utiliser dans un code php, qui rend l'entrée de l'utilisateur sûre pour la base de données? Je connais l'élimination des espaces avant et après la chaîne. rayant les barres obliques de la chaîne.Quelle est la meilleure fonction pour sécuriser la saisie de l'utilisateur dans la base de données?

et quoi d'autre? Et pouvons-nous utiliser cette fonction dans un script de connexion? et y a-t-il d'autres problèmes de sécurité dont nous devons nous inquiéter?

et merci beaucoup: D

+2

Cela dépend de la bibliothèque de base de données que vous utilisez. Chaque bibliothèque apporte sa propre fonction d'assainissement. Suppression des barres obliques et des espaces ne aidera pas –

+0

PDO est la solution réelle, puisque vous écrivez une instruction préparée en préparant votre base de données à une certaine requête. Ainsi, la base de données peut elle-même comprendre ce qu'est un argument et ce qui fait partie de la chaîne de requête. – Shoe

Répondre

Questions connexes